10-15-2007, 05:30 PM #8
I removed the links.
Failsafe: Log in and check your actual account messages for any activity.
Also,for future reference(term ebay scam email )
If in doubt just Forward the whole email to either
spoof-at-paypal.com
spoof-at-ebay.com
You will get a verification email directly from them.
